Common Lennox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in Washington

  • Clogged secondary heat exchangers on Lennox Elite models. Fine coal and soot particulate from former combustion heating lingers in Washington’s older homes for decades after conversion. This residue accumulates in the tightly finned secondary heat exchangers of Elite Series furnaces, reducing efficiency and risking rollout. We remove this with HEPA-rated extraction, not compressed-air blowouts that redistribute the problem.
  • Restricted airflow in Lennox Signature Collection systems. Undersized retrofitted duct runs, common in Victorian-era Washington homes, create velocity problems that amplify lint and debris accumulation. The Signature line’s variable-speed blowers compensate temporarily, but eventually strain against static pressure that proper cleaning and sealing can resolve.
  • Evaporator coil corrosion on Lennox Merit units. Washington’s position in the Pohatcong Creek valley traps humid air, and inadequate duct sealing in older homes lets that moisture reach the coil. Acidic condensation accelerates corrosion. We inspect, clean, and seal to break that cycle.
  • Blower motor overheating from excessive dust loading. Non-standard duct configurations in pre-war railroad worker houses create dead zones where particulate settles, then surges into the blower during high-demand winter heating. Washington’s extended heating season — October through April — makes this a recurring issue.
  • Particulate re-entry through deteriorating duct joints. Original sheet-metal ductwork from mid-century conversions features riveted joints that loosen over decades. Cleaning without subsequent sealing leaves homeowners breathing the same debris six months later.

Lennox Service Pricing in Washington

our Air Duct Cleaning in Washington typically runs $350–$650 for a standard residential system, with commercial and multi-unit properties quoted individually. What moves you within that range:

  • System size and register count: A compact ranch with 8–10 supply registers sits at the lower end; a Victorian with 15+ registers and multiple returns climbs higher.
  • Access difficulty: Crawlspace ductwork, sealed chases, or limited basement headroom add labor time.
  • Contamination level: Heavy soot loading from prior coal or fuel oil heating requires extended HEPA extraction cycles.
  • Sealing needs: Deteriorating joints in original conversion-era ductwork add mastic sealing labor but prevent re-contamination.
